    Bilateral ski patrol training during Northern Viper 2020 [Image 15 of 15]

    Bilateral ski patrol training during Northern Viper 2020

    YAUSUBETSU TRAINING AREA, HOKKAIDO, JAPAN

    01.23.2020

    Photo by Lance Cpl. Jackson Dukes 

    3rd Marine Division     

    U.S. Marines from Alpha Company, 1st Battalion, 25th Marine Regiment, currently assigned to 4th Marine Regiment, 3rd Marine Division, conduct bilateral ski patrol training with Soldiers from 5th Brigade, Japan Ground Self-Defense Force (JGSDF), during exercise Northern Viper on Yausubetsu Training Area, Hokkaido, Japan, Jan. 23, 2020. Northern Viper is a regularly scheduled training exercise that is designed to enhance the collective defense capabilities of the U.S. and Japan Alliance by allowing infantry units to maintain their lethality and proficiency in infantry and combined arms tactics. This iteration of the exercise is executed by units across III Marine Expeditionary Force including an activated reserve unit, 1st Battalion, 25th Marine Regiment, currently attached to 4th Marine Regiment, 3rd Marine Division, as part of the unit deployment program, alongside their counterparts from 5th Brigade, Japan Ground Self-Defense Force.
